What is Nasi Kandar?

Nasi kandar originates from the state of Penang in Malaysia. The name itself signifies its humble beginnings - "nasi" meaning rice and "kandar" referring to the traditional street vendors who used to carry their food on a shoulder pole called a "kandar."

The dish features fluffy white rice, often cooked in a blend of spices and fragrant pandan leaves, served alongside an array of curries, side dishes, and condiments.
